Approach-Focused Online Therapy with a Licensed Social Worker



Attachment-Based Therapy looks at how early relationships shape how people connect with others and manage emotions. This approach can help clients explore patterns in relationships, address attachment issues, and build more secure ways of relating. Client-Centered Therapy emphasizes empathic listening and collaboration, allowing clients to lead sessions while the therapist offers validation and support to foster self-awareness and personal growth.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) focuses on identifying unhelpful thoughts and behaviors and developing practical skills to manage symptoms like anxiety, panic, or depression.
